Will Amazon KDP accept the files?

That’s what the print-ready interior is for. It’s a true 6 × 9 inch trim with the fonts embedded, a wider margin on the bound edge where the binding eats into the page, and no cover inside it — print-on-demand services want the cover as a separate file and reject interiors that include one.
